GET TO KNOW YOUR TEAM:

  • Utica Park Clinic, founded in 1982, is a multi-specialty medical group with more than 300 employed physicians and advanced practice providers representing over 25 specialties across 80 plus clinics in Oklahoma.
    Responsibilities:

The Senior Data Analyst will report directly to the Population Health Director and will provide technical and analytical support to the population health activities of Utica Park Clinic and the Hillcrest Healthcare System.

  • Develop, maintain, and enhance reports related to quality improvement initiatives using Epic and Power BI.
  • Analyze healthcare data to support provider, staff, and population health performance metrics.
  • Collaborate closely with Quality and Population Health Managers, the Medical Director, and other stakeholders to identify reporting needs.
  • Ensure accuracy and validation of all reports and dashboards.
  • Support bonus calculations tied to quality performance for providers and staff.
  • Translate clinical and operational data into actionable insights for leadership

Work Schedule: Hybrid, (Tuesdays & Thursdays on-site at 7600 S. Lewis, Tulsa; remote on other days)
Qualifications:

Job Requirements:

  • Two years in data tracking and report generation.
  • Associates Degree in Healthcare or related field

Preferred Qualifications:

  • Experience with Epic, especially Cogito and/or Cadence strongly preferred
  • Power BI proficiency strongly preferred
  • Strong understanding of healthcare quality metrics and reporting standards.
  • Ability to work independently and confidently on data projects with minimal supervision.
  • Prior experience in a healthcare or healthcare IT environment
